Software Engineer

Fulltime automates the fight against heart disease, using Artificial Intelligence. Our product needs to handle large volumes of echocardiograms at scale, and quickly provide comprehensive patient reports to customers. We’re looking for software engineers to work on improving our software, adding new features and integrating it with external customer systems. We need our engineers to be versatile, display leadership qualities and be enthusiastic to take on new problems across the full-stack as we continue to push our technology forwards.

Minimum qualifications:

  • Bachelor’s degree or equivalent practical experience.
  • 3 years of software development experience, or 1 year with an advanced degree.
  • Experience in web technologies like HTML/CSS/JS along with experience in one or more frameworks such as Angular/React/Vue/Ionic
  • Proficient in Python
  • Experience with implementing RESTful services
  • Experience with NoSQL databases such as MongoDB/DynamoDB

Preferred qualifications:

  • Master’s degree, PhD, further education or experience in Computer Science or a related technical field.
  • Experience with cloud development (AWS, Azure, Watson, etc.)
  • Experience with Terraform
  • Ability to write in English fluently.
  • Ability to learn other coding languages as needed.
  • Experience with clinical systems/protocol such as PACS, DICOM, HL7, EHR and more!


  • Design, develop, test, deploy, maintain, and improve the software.
  • Manage individual project priorities, deadlines, and deliverables.